docker 软连接修改存储位置

打印 上一主题 下一主题

主题 833|帖子 833|积分 2499


  • 查看docker路径
    默认情况下Docker的存放位置为:/var/lib/docker,也可以通过如下命令查看docker存储路径
    docker info | grep "Docker Root Dir"
  • 停掉docker服务
    systemctl stop docker
  • 移动docker目录
    mv /var/lib/docker /var/sda1/docker_home
    为了保险起见可以先复制
    cp -rf /var/lib/docker /var/sda1/docker_home
    然后删掉文件目录
    rm -rf /var/lib/docker
  • 创建软链接
    /home/docker_home为源文件目录,也就是新设置的docker存储目录
    /var/lib/docker为软链接目标目录,与此目录建立链接后,相当于原来的docker配置保持稳定,但真正的存储目录是其背后所指向的/home/docker_home
    ln -s /var/sda1/docker_home /var/lib/docker
  • 启动docker服务
    systemctl start docker
  • 修改完成后,我们可以通过以下命令查看docker的存储目录:
  1. docker info | grep "Root Dir"  
  2. # 修改成功会返回以下内容:
  3. # Docker Root Dir: /home/docker_home
复制代码

  • 查看/var/lib/目录,docker目录是一个软链接,指向/var/sda1/docker_home,配置正确。

免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。
回复

使用道具 举报

0 个回复

倒序浏览

快速回复

您需要登录后才可以回帖 登录 or 立即注册

本版积分规则

杀鸡焉用牛刀

金牌会员
这个人很懒什么都没写!

标签云

快速回复 返回顶部 返回列表